Review snapshot
Public employee feedback for Fortrea is mixed-positive overall. Reviews often mention good teams,flexibility,and reasonable work-life balance,but the negatives focus on career progression,uneven management,and stress following organizational change and separation from Labcorp. Employees seem to view it as a workable large-CRO environment,with experience varying noticeably by manager and function.
